Topics Covered
- 1. Fundamentals of Network Performance and Reliability: Learners will study core network principles and key performance metrics, understanding how to measure and improve network reliability. They will gain foundational skills in analyzing network traffic and identifying common performance issues.
- 2. Network Architecture and Design: This module covers design principles for scalable and resilient network architectures, including redundancy strategies and failover mechanisms. Learners will develop skills in designing networks that meet specific performance and reliability criteria.
- 3. Network Monitoring and Performance Analysis: Learners will learn to use various tools and techniques for real-time network monitoring and performance analysis. They will gain expertise in interpreting network data and making informed decisions to optimize performance.
- 4. Troubleshooting Network Issues: This module focuses on advanced troubleshooting techniques for diagnosing and resolving complex network problems. Learners will practice identifying and fixing issues related to network performance, connectivity, and reliability.
- 5. Network Security Fundamentals: Learners will study the basics of network security, including methods to protect networks from threats and maintain high levels of security. They will learn practical skills in implementing security protocols and monitoring network security.
- 6. Advanced Network Protocols and Technologies: This module delves into advanced network protocols and emerging technologies, such as SDN (Software-Defined Networking) and NFV (Network Functions Virtualization). Learners will explore how these technologies can enhance network performance and reliability.
- 7. Quality of Service (QoS) Configuration: Learners will study QoS principles and techniques for configuring QoS policies to prioritize network traffic and ensure optimal performance for critical applications. They will gain hands-on experience in implementing QoS in various network environments.
- 8. Network Backup and Recovery Strategies: This module covers strategies for implementing and managing network backup and recovery systems. Learners will learn how to design and test backup plans to ensure network reliability and quick recovery from failures.
- 9. Automation and Scripting for Network Management: Learners will learn to automate network management tasks using scripting languages and automation tools. They will gain skills in writing scripts to monitor network performance, manage network devices, and perform routine administrative tasks.
- 10. Case Studies in Network Optimization: Learners will analyze real-world case studies to understand how network optimization and reliability are applied in various industries. They will gain insight into best practices and innovative solutions for optimizing network performance and reliability.
